Julie Humphris, an Admin Assistant and Earl Shilton resident, has been able to move up the property ladder after saving with esbs.

Admin Assistant Julie Humphris first approached the Society in 2017 to open a Regular Monthly Saver account with the view to setting aside a nest egg for herself.

Open to UK residents aged 12 or over, the Regular Monthly Saver account provides members with a means of building up funds by putting away a certain amount of money each month.

“What I really liked about the account was the fact that I was able to put a specific amount to one side every month, which really helped me to discipline myself and be careful with my money,” Julie explains.

“I also found the flexibility of the account appealing, seeing as I was able to make a minimum deposit of £10 and a maximum deposit of £500 per month.”

Having her savings in order allowed Julie to move out of her one-bedroom apartment and purchase her new two-bedroom, semi-detached house, which she moved into in September 2018.
